Action Research Community High School seeks a founding Principal to serve as the instructional and cultural leader for Milwaukee's first Gold Standard project-based learning high school. Opening Fall 2026, ARCHS will serve 80 students in grades 9-12 on Milwaukee's South Side, growing to 160 students at capacity.

The Principal reports to the Executive Director and is responsible for daily operations, instructional leadership, staff development, and school culture. This is a unique opportunity to build a school from the ground up—designing systems, hiring a founding team, and establishing the practices that will define ARCHS for years to come.

Our model centers Gold Standard PBL (Buck Institute/PBL Works), restorative justice practices, and deep community partnerships. The Principal must be a hands-on instructional leader who can coach teachers in PBL, model relationship-centered practices, and translate our IDEAS values (Interdependence, Dignity, Exploration, Advocacy, Self-awareness) into daily school life.

Key Responsibilities

        Provide instructional leadership for Gold Standard project-based learning implementation

        Coach and develop Core Advisors in PBL design, facilitation, and assessment

        Manage daily school operations, including scheduling, facilities, and student services

        Lead implementation of restorative justice practices and maintain school culture grounded in IDEAS values

        Build and maintain relationships with students, families, and community partners

        Hire, supervise, and evaluate founding teaching staff

        Monitor student achievement data and ensure progress toward school goals (including 3+ point ACT growth)

        Ensure compliance with UW-Milwaukee charter requirements and Wisconsin DPI regulations

Required Qualifications

        Valid Wisconsin Principal license (DPI 51) or equivalent out-of-state credential with reciprocity eligibility

        Minimum 5 years successful classroom teaching experience

        Minimum 3 years school leadership experience (assistant principal, department chair, instructional coach, or equivalent)

        Demonstrated experience with project-based learning or inquiry-driven instruction

        Bilingual Spanish-English proficiency (required for effective engagement with our predominantly Latino community)

Preferred Qualifications

        Experience leading or founding a charter, magnet, or innovative school

        Project based learning in K-12 settings

        Training in restorative justice or restorative practices

        Master's degree in Educational Leadership, Curriculum & Instruction, or related field

        Connection to Milwaukee's South Side community

Benefits

        Wisconsin Retirement System (WRS) enrollment

        Comprehensive health, dental, and vision insurance

        4 weeks paid vacation + sick leave

        Professional development budget including PBL Works training

        Founding leadership opportunity to shape school from inception
